Tragic Discovery on the Yacht
Two sailors' bodies were found on board a yacht, who, according to preliminary data, may have fallen victim to a pirate attack. 67-year-old Deirdre 'Cookie' Subley and her friend Pascal had 'adventures of a lifetime' off the coast of South Africa when police found them unconscious on the vessel.Subley's sister, Sue Good, said: “They were on an adventure they dreamed of...”The circumstances of their death are currently under investigation, and the reasons for the tragedy remain unclear.In cases of piracy in South African waters, the situation remains tense, and authorities are taking measures to ensure the safety of navigation. This tragedy only underscores the need for enhanced measures to protect sailors in high-risk areas.
